Jennifer Lawrence

by Molly Aloian

Published 30 November 2012
Barely into her twenties, actress Jennifer Lawrence has quickly risen to superstar status after appearing in the mega-hit movie The Hunger Games. Acting in local theater at an early age, she worked hard to finish high school two years early so she could go to New York to fulfill her acting dreams. Very quickly, her work received nominations for a Golden Globe and an Academy Award. This entertaining biography highlights the life and accomplishments of the young star, including her childhood, her quick rise to fame, and her plans for the future.

Rihanna

by Molly Aloian

Published 15 May 2013
Robyn Rihanna Fenty came to the United States from Barbados at the age of 16. A year later she burst onto the music charts with her first album Music of the Sun. Rihanna hasn't looked back. With seven successful studio albums, all before the age of 25, she is one of the best-selling musical artists of all time. This fascinating book about Rihanna reveals the facts about the woman Time magazine listed as one of the most influential people of 2012. But success has not come without a price. She has had struggles in her personal life to overcome, much of it in the unforgiving glare of the spotlight.

One Direction

by Molly Aloian

Published 15 May 2013
Meet the boys behind the new British Invasion! This exciting new biography tells the incredible story of pop group One Direction. From their start on the UK TV show X Factor to sold-out concerts, MTV Video Music Awards, and chart-topping hits, Harry, Niall, Liam, Louis, and Zayn show no signs of slowing down. The group’s first album Up All Night made history as the first debut album by a British group to enter at number one on the US Billboard 200 chart. Full-color photos and fascinating facts make this book a must for any “Directioner.”

Demi Lovato

by Molly Aloian

Published 15 May 2013
Demi Lovato’s accomplishments include Disney star, best-selling recording artist, and judge on the hit TV show X Factor. Her rise to fame has not been without hardships, however. Demi has shared her personal struggles with depression, bulimia, and self-injury in an effort to raise awareness. Full-color photographs, personal stories, and quotes from Demi herself, give readers the inside scoop on this inspiring star.
